Corporate sponsorship in the UAE is a key aspect of business operations for foreign investors and companies looking to establish a presence in the region. In the UAE, foreign investors are often required to have a local sponsor or partner, typically a UAE national, to set up a business in certain jurisdictions, especially in mainland areas. The local sponsor holds a majority share (51...